Summary
"Tryptophan is an α-amino acid that is used in the biosynthesis of proteins...It is essential in humans, meaning that the body cannot synthesize it and it must be obtained from the diet. Tryptophan is also a precursor to the neurotransmitter serotonin, the hormone melatonin, and vitamin B3."
